There is a Snow Trac for sale at Jax Outdoor Gear in Fort Collins CO it is basically a camping store that also deals in miltary surplus. I saw it there for the first time yesterday so I know it hasn't been there long. The guy with the infomation at Jax is Mike Music telephone number 970 221-0544. He is out until Monday. The guy on the phone who gave me Mike's name did tell me that it runs and that they are asking $10,500 for it. It had hydraulics on it including a winch up front, what looked like a plastic motor boat fuel tank strapped on the front of the fender. It had a small cab not the full cab. In the cab it had the drivers seat and then a second foldable bench seat mounted perpendicular to the drivers seat. It looked to be in fair shape.

Sound like it might be a Snow Master version of the Snow Trac. I rarely even see photos of with the hydraulics left in tact. So if this one has hydraulics, and better yet if they work, it might be an ideal machine for someone who is looking for a machine that can do some grooming or other work.
